He was brought to the psychiatric ward in chains by hefty men. He stood up aggressively with terrifying look and started speaking in tongues. He pointed finger at us and threatened to curse anyone who touched him by the "anointing and unction upon his head". Obviously, he was a "Man of God".
While I was still wondering what could have happened to the MOG, few days later another man of God was brought by his wife and church members.
Why would a man of God run mad? I asked myself. Out of curiosity, I engaged the wife in an intimate discussion, not as a doctor now but as fellow believer.
The wife confided in me and said, she was a church founder of over 300 members, called of God into the prophetic ministry. But when she got married, the husband will never allow her minister in her church again, instead he would always subdue her and take her ministration slots in the church.
So one day he was conducting a deliverance session, a meeting the wife was supposed to lead. And after the meeting he couldn't stop praying. Initially they felt it was revival.
But he continued praying like that for days and started talking out of context. 
At that point, they bundled him to the mental clinic.
